Lion Global Investors Launches Singapore’s First Actively Managed ETF in Collaboration with Nomura Asset Management

Published

on

The Lion-Nomura Japan Active ETF (Powered by AI) will be Singapore’s first active ETF on the Singapore Exchange and Singapore’s first AI-powered ETF. It has three key features:

Actively Managed: Focuses on 50-100 Japanese companies with high capital appreciation potential[1].Intelligent: Lion Global Investors’ and Nomura Asset Management’s proprietary AI models work faster than humans and can evaluate hundreds of factors for securities selection.Dynamic: AI models are refreshed monthly, enabling them to respond to trends dynamically.

SINGAPORE, Jan. 12,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Lion Global Investors (LGI) today announced the launch of Singapore’s first actively managed ETF, in collaboration with Nomura Asset Management group (NAM), the Lion-Nomura Japan Active ETF (Powered by AI). It is Singapore’s first active ETF and also its first AI-powered one.

 

The Lion-Nomura Japan Active ETF (Powered by AI) offers clients exposure to the Japan stock market through an actively managed portfolio of 50-100 securities listed in Japan. It seeks to provide long-term capital growth by investing primarily based on results from LGI’s and NAM’s proprietary art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ning models that look at fundamental, technical, qualitative and quantitative analyses.

Teo Joo Wah, CEO, Lion Global Investors said that the launch of the Lion-Nomura Japan Active ETF (Powered by AI) and LGI’s expansion into the active ETF space underscores the firm’s mission to align to clients’ desire for cost-effective solutions that are actively managed and nimble for more efficient portfolio management, especially in today’s evolving macroeconomic environment.

 “Expanding our offerings to include active ETFs represents our response to evolving investor demand and our commitment to broadening access to LGI’s strategies. The launch of our first active ETF on a Japan-focused theme using AI models in collaboration with Nomura Asset Management reflects our joint commitment to deliver efficient investment solutions to investors in Singapore.” 

With retail investors showing a greater appetite for ETF investing since 2019, it is a strategic move by Singapore Exchange (SGX Group) to embark on the listing of Active ETFs in 2024 to harness the growth potential of this thriving ETF environment.

“SGX Group congratulates Lion Global Investors and Nomura Asset Management on pioneering Singapore’s first active ETF. This marks a new milestone in our expanding ETF shelf, showcasing product innovation and diversity for increased investor adoption in the ETF ecosystem. By leveraging AI, this active ETF adopts a dynamic approach, enabling the investment managers to respond to market changes through more frequent portfolio re-balancing. This launch also presents a timely opportunity for investors to capitalise on the resurgence of interest in the Japanese stock market,” said Janice Kan, Co-Head of Equities, SGX Group.

Providing investors easy access to Japan

Teo added that AI and Japan are themes that investors have shown strong interest in recent times. “AI is a capability that LGI has been developing since 2019. The Japanese market is supported by several tailwinds such as corporate governance reforms and strong foreign investor interest, which we expect to continue to drive momentum.  We are therefore excited to offer clients a new strategy that can help them access Japan via an actively managed ETF. We are happy that this collaboration will allow Singapore investors to benefit from NAM’s deep experience and knowledge of Japan and AI.”

Takahiro Kawabe, Managing Director and CEO, Nomura Asset Management Singapore Limited, said, “The Lion-Nomura Japan Active ETF (Powered by AI) leverages on NAM’s legacy of 65 years of leadership and experience investing in Japanese companies while offering the additional benefits of an active ETF structure including market access to Japan, nimble portfolio management and better risk management. While we are a leader in Japan ETFs and have recently launched our first two active ETFs there, this is our first for Singapore in collaboration with LGI.” 

Initial Offering Period 

The Initial Offering Period (IOP) of the Lion-Nomura Japan Active ETF (Powered by AI) is from January 5 to 25, 2024. It lists on the Singapore Exchange (SGX) on January 31, 2024 and will be available in both Singapore and US dollar denominations under the SGX code JJJ and JUS respectively. The issue price of each unit during the IOP is SGD 1.00.

During the IOP, investors may subscribe to the ETF through OCBC ATMs/internet banking/mobile banking and participating dealers including iFAST Financial Pte. Ltd., Moomoo Financial Singapore Pte. Ltd., OCBC Securities Pte. Ltd., Phillip Securities Pte. Ltd. and Tiger Brokers (Singapore) Pte. Ltd.

Automotive Seat Heater Market to Reach $5.5 Billion, Globally, by 2033 at 6% CAGR: Allied Market Research

Published

on

By

Key factors contributing to the growth of the automotive heat seater market include advancements in heating technology, such as the integration of more efficient heating elements and improved temperature control systems.

WILMINGTON, Del., Sept. 20,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Allied Market Research published a report, titled, “Automotive seat heater Market by Type (Carbon Heater and Composite Heater), Vehicle Type (Passenger Cars and Commercial Vehicles), and Sales Channel (OEM and Aftermarket): Global Opportunity Analysis and Industry Forecast, 2024-2033″. According to the report, the automotive seat heater market was valued at $3.1 billion in 2023, and is estimated to reach $5.5 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 6% from 2024 to 2033.

The global automotive seat heaters market is driven by increased demand for comfort and customization. As increasing numbers of individuals utilize the roads, the number of affordable vehicles available in recent years has skyrocketed. As a result, there is a greater need for vehicles with interiors that are both visually appealing and practical. The market for vehicle interior materials is being driven by rising consumer demand for customization and technical developments across the industry. In response to client demand, companies are now offering customization choices for creating modern interiors. Consumers increasing health consciousness is also driving the development of environmentally friendly automotive interior materials that contribute to increased comfort.

Prime determinants of growth 

The growing level of competition in the automotive industry is a primary driver of the automotive seat heater market’s expansion. Furthermore, improving consumer affordability, rising consumer income, and the availability of easy financing to purchase a vehicle are all driving forces in the global automobile sector. Furthermore, expansion in the automobile industry causes growth in the global market. Rising popularity of carbon fiber technology, rising demand for comfort and energy efficiency in vehicles, and rising preferences for high-end passenger cars are some of the major and insightful factors that will most likely drive the growth of the automotive seat heater market during the forecast period. The health benefits, such as reduction from discomfort backs and rapid warming, are driving market expansion. The expanding aftermarket sales of car seat heaters are driving the market forward.

By Type 

The carbon heater segment is expected to grow faster throughout the forecast period.

The carbon heater segment is anticipated to experience faster growth in the automotive seat heater market. Carbon fiber meshed weave heating pads will remain the largest market segment as this type of seat heater ensures good strength and requires very low voltage to produce heat. a growing preference for energy-efficient and environmentally friendly components, aligning with the broader push towards sustainable automotive solutions. The integration of advanced technologies, such as automatic climate control systems that adjust seat heating based on ambient temperature and individual preferences, is becoming increasingly popular.  

By Vehicle Type

The passenger car segment is expected to grow faster throughout the forecast period.

The passenger car segment is anticipated to experience growth in the automotive seat heater market. The increasing expenditure on passenger and driver comfort. The development of premium features and the surge in passenger vehicle numbers in Europe and North America significantly contribute to this growth. Additionally, there is a rising demand for SUVs and luxury vehicles in emerging markets. Automotive manufacturers are continuously innovating electronic technologies, which create new opportunities for the application of heated seats in passenger cars. This trend is further bolstered by the emphasis on enhancing vehicle comfort and the integration of advanced climate control systems. 

Procure Complete Report (324 Pages PDF with In-depth Insights, Charts, Tables, and Figures): https://www.alliedmarketresearch.com/checkout-final/automotive-seat-heater-market-A323768

By Sales Channel

The aftermarket segment is expected to grow faster throughout the forecast period.

The aftermarket segment is anticipated to experience growth in the automotive seat heater market. One of the standardization of temperature control seats in various mid-range and high-end vehicles is helping the OEM section of the automobile seat heater industry. Seat heater replacement rates are predicted to rise due to excessive wear and tear, as well as changing climatic circumstances in cold locations, driving up aftermarket sales. When compared to OEM products, aftermarket products are more cost-effective. Furthermore, owners of vehicles without seat heaters add this equipment in the aftermarket, which boosts seat heater aftermarket sales.

By Region

Europe to maintain its dominance by 2033.

Europe is expected to maintain its dominance in the automotive heat seater market by 2033 owing to robust industrialization, infrastructural development, and growing investments in automotive and manufacturing sectors. has witnessed a surge in the popularity and necessity of automotive seat heaters. As the nation’s economy expands and consumer prosperity grows, there is a corresponding increase in the demand for vehicles equipped with advanced comfort amenities. Once considered a luxury, seat heaters are now becoming more accessible to a wider demographic, fueling their adoption among consumers.

Europe will maintain its pivotal role as a significant market for automotive seat heaters. This is primarily due to the increasing demand from end users who prioritize cabin comfort, especially in the winter months. Seat heaters are favored for their ability to significantly enhance occupant comfort during this season.
